Chapter 13 · Verse 12
Yoga through Distinguishing the Field and the Knower of the Field
अध्यात्मज्ञाननित्यत्वं तत्त्वज्ञानार्थदर्शनम्।एतज्ज्ञानमिति प्रोक्तमज्ञानं यदतोन्यथा
adhyātma-jñāna-nityatvaṁ tattva-jñānārtha-darśhanam etaj jñānam iti proktam ajñānaṁ yad ato ’nyathā
Word Meanings
adhyātma — spiritual; jñāna — knowledge; nityatvam — constancy; tattva-jñāna — knowledge of spiritual principles; artha — for; darśhanam — philosophy; etat — all this; jñānam — knowledge; iti — thus; proktam — declared; ajñānam — ignorance; yat — what; ataḥ — to this; anyathā — contrary
Translation
Constancy in spiritual self-knowledge, and perception of the goal of knowing the Truth—this is declared to be knowledge, and whatever is contrary to this is ignorance.
